在使用 MySQL 進行查詢時,有時會遇到查詢時間過長或查詢結果過多等情況,此時需要終止查詢操作。下面我們介紹在 MySQL 中如何終止查詢操作。
MySQL 中終止查詢有兩種方式: 1.使用 Ctrl+C 終止查詢,但是這種方式可能會造成 MySQL 進程異常退出,不推薦使用。 2.使用 KILL 命令終止查詢,該命令可以殺死指定連接的進程,不會影響 MySQL 實例的運行狀態。
下面是使用 KILL 命令終止查詢的具體步驟:
1.首先需要查找要終止的查詢的進程 ID。可以使用命令 SHOW PROCESSLIST; 查看當前的 MySQL 連接狀態,找到要終止的進程對應的 ID。(例如,進程 ID 為 12345) 2.使用命令 KILL 12345; 終止進程。注意,這里的進程 ID 為上一步中查找到的進程 ID。
使用 KILL 命令終止查詢可以確保 MySQL 運行狀態不受影響,同時也能夠有效地終止長時間運行的查詢。但我們平常使用 MySQL 時,為了避免出現需要手動終止查詢的情況,應該合理優化 SQL 語句和數據庫索引。
上一篇模板引用css
下一篇水波紋擴散效果css